 OutlineGod's people don't engage the enemy in their own strength, they run to God in faith. The way of faith must be honest, humble and repentant. The way of faith surrenders to the will of God with hope. God’s promises in His word are trustworthy. Jesus defeated our enemy in His strength, he has taken every sin, has our life secured with him in heaven and is now interceding on or behalf. Home Group Questions    Rather than engage the enemy, Hezekiah instructed his representatives to not speak and he did not respond either. When and why can this be a wise strategy? How should Hezekiah’s strategy of going into the presence of God and seeking help from someone who knows the word of God, be a good model for us in times of distress, temptation, giving into sin and doubt? Why is it sometimes people’s instinct to stay away from God and His people when we most need them? How can we encourage people not to respond this way?    Hezekiah acknowledges they are in this position because of sin. How does understanding sin as betrayal, not just breaking a law, lead us to greater humility, repentance and worship?    In Jesus we see the coming together of the offices of prophet, priest and king. How does Isaiah’s role in this story point us to Jesus?    Isaiah’s answer was simply, trust God’s promises. God had already spoken, so His people could trust His promise before they saw His deliverance. What promises of God have strengthened your faith during difficult times? How can we encourage one another to trust God’s Word even when we cannot yet see how He will act?
